你这是典型的 C 程序员的思维。缺少抽象,所以每个项目都要写很多代码。
c++ 虽然比较丑。但是表达能力确实算主流语言里面较强的。有个抽象好的标准库,比如 boost, QtCore 之后,很省代码,开发速度很快。
BlockingQueue 是 MQ 在单机的抽象。如果再搭配 ThreadPool 的 map/imap/map_unorder ed,写代码时非常爽。
【 在 ylh0315 的大作中提到: 】
: 哪有那么费事,libc里一大堆pthread_打头的函数。
: 我都是用这些函数进行线程间通信。
: 实在不行,还有fifo,pipe,socket。
: ...................
--
FROM 117.28.155.*